The History of the Pullover
The pullover, also known as a jumper or sweater, has a long history dating back to medieval Europe. Originally worn by fishermen and athletes for warmth and comfort, the pullover has evolved into a fashion staple for people of all ages. Its simple design and ease of wear have made it popular worldwide.
Types of Pullovers
There are several types of pullovers to choose from, including crewneck, V-neck, turtleneck, and hoodie styles. Each style offers a different neckline and silhouette, catering to individual preferences and fashion trends. Whether you prefer a classic look or a more modern design, there is a pullover style for everyone.
Materials and Construction
Pullovers are made from various materials such as cotton, wool, cashmere, or synthetic blends. The choice of material affects the pullover's warmth, softness, and durability. In terms of construction, pullovers can be machine-knit, hand-knit, or mass-produced, with each method influencing the garment's quality and price.

Caring for Your Pullover
To keep your pullover in top condition, it's essential to follow proper care instructions. Most pullovers can be machine washed or hand washed, depending on the fabric. Be sure to air dry your pullover to prevent shrinking or stretching, and store it folded to maintain its shape.
